2. How do I verify if a bike is registered with the Shangus RTO (JK-03)?
You can verify the registration on the Parivahan Sewa website or app. Enter the vehicle number and ensure the "Registering Authority" is Anantnag/Shangus (JK-03).
3. What documents are required for RC transfer in Jammu & Kashmir?
To transfer ownership at the Shangus RTO, you need:
Original RC (Registration Certificate)
Forms 29 & 30 (signed by buyer and seller)
Valid Insurance and PUC certificate
Chassis and Engine pencil imprints
Address proof of the buyer in Shangus

5. How much is the RC transfer fee in Shangus?
The government fee is approximately ₹350 to ₹450. Ensure the bike has no pending tax dues before purchasing.
6. How can I check a used bike for hill damage?
Given the hilly terrain towards Kokernag and Achabal, we check:
Clutch Plates: For slippage or burning from constant gradient riding.
Suspension: For leaks or weakness on winding roads.
Brake Pads/Discs: For excessive wear due to downhill braking.
7. Is a Pollution Under Control (PUC) certificate mandatory?
Yes. Riding without a valid PUC can result in fines. Always ensure the seller provides a current certificate.
